Street Markets to Explore in Idukki

Checkout places to visit in Idukki

Idukki

Into the clouds. Hill stations, waterfalls, tea plantations, high altitude peaks.

Activities Around

Street Markets to Explore in Idukki

Echo Point

Situated at the bank of lake overlooking mountains, the place got it's name from the loud echo it makes.

Map of Street Markets to explore in Idukki